Time travel is a scientific fact. It’s not an hypothesis or a theory, but a fact. It all springs from Einstein’s Theory of Special Relativity. The faster you go, the more you time-travel into the Earth’s future. This has been verified many times in the lab with small particles.
Ah, but here comes the sad part. You must travel close to the speed of light for the effect to be noticeable. That’s doable for small particles, but not for large objects like people. The energy required would be prohibitive.
